313<p>
314        The <a class="link" href="basic_waitable_timer.html" title="basic_waitable_timer"><code class="computeroutput">basic_waitable_timer</code></a>
315        class template provides the ability to perform a blocking or asynchronous
316        wait for a timer to expire.
317      </p>
318<p>
319        A waitable timer is always in one of two states: "expired" or "not
320        expired". If the <code class="computeroutput">wait()</code> or <code class="computeroutput">async_wait()</code> function
321        is called on an expired timer, the wait operation will complete immediately.
322      </p>
323<p>
324        Most applications will use one of the <a class="link" href="steady_timer.html" title="steady_timer"><code class="computeroutput">steady_timer</code></a>,
325        <a class="link" href="system_timer.html" title="system_timer"><code class="computeroutput">system_timer</code></a>
326        or <a class="link" href="high_resolution_timer.html" title="high_resolution_timer"><code class="computeroutput">high_resolution_timer</code></a>
327        typedefs.
328      </p>

384<h5>
385<a name="boost_asio.reference.system_timer.h5"></a>
386        <span class="phrase"><a name="boost_asio.reference.system_timer.changing_an_active_waitable_timer_s_expiry_time"></a></span><a class="link" href="system_timer.html#boost_asio.reference.system_timer.changing_an_active_waitable_timer_s_expiry_time">Changing
387        an active waitable timer's expiry time</a>
388      </h5>
389<p>
390        Changing the expiry time of a timer while there are pending asynchronous
391        waits causes those wait operations to be cancelled. To ensure that the action
392        associated with the timer is performed only once, use something like this:
393        used:
394      </p>
395<pre class="programlisting">void on_some_event()
396{
397  if (my_timer.expires_after(seconds(5)) &gt; 0)
398  {
399    // We managed to cancel the timer. Start new asynchronous wait.
400    my_timer.async_wait(on_timeout);
401  }
402  else
403  {
404    // Too late, timer has already expired!
405  }
406}
407
408void on_timeout(const boost::system::error_code&amp; e)
409{
410  if (e != boost::asio::error::operation_aborted)
411  {
412    // Timer was not cancelled, take necessary action.
413  }
414}
415</pre>
416<div class="itemizedlist"><ul class="itemizedlist" style="list-style-type: disc; ">
417<li class="listitem">
418            The <code class="computeroutput">boost::asio::basic_waitable_timer::expires_after()</code> function
419            cancels any pending asynchronous waits, and returns the number of asynchronous
420            waits that were cancelled. If it returns 0 then you were too late and
421            the wait handler has already been executed, or will soon be executed.
422            If it returns 1 then the wait handler was successfully cancelled.
423          </li>
424<li class="listitem">
425            If a wait handler is cancelled, the boost::system::error_code passed
426            to it contains the value <code class="computeroutput">boost::asio::error::operation_aborted</code>.
427          </li>
428</ul></div>
